Homebrew is it possible to replace a homebrew icon?

wormdood

pirate booty inspector
OP
Member
Joined
Jan 3, 2014
Messages
5,256
Trophies
2
Age
38
Location
behind a parental advisory sticker
XP
4,191
Country
United States
hello i have been using @Apache Thunder's app to run my original r4 on my 3ds and the icon is fine for me . . . but i intend to set up a 3ds for my nephew and would like to change the icon to something . . . more eye catching to a child and so i wanted to know if/how i would go about changing the image.
 
  • Like
Reactions: Deleted User
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
Are you referring to NTR Launcher?

icon.png


NTR Launcher
NitroHax provided by chishm
Modified by Apache Thunder

Is so, what do you prefer this icon to be and those lines written as?
 

SCOTT0852

shiny rubber creature
Member
Joined
Jan 20, 2018
Messages
1,140
Trophies
0
Location
The Moon
XP
1,133
Country
United States
If the source code is available, it shouldn't be too hard to replace the files before you compile. I'm not sure how hard it is to actually compile though.
 
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
If the source code is available, it shouldn't be too hard to replace the files before you compile. I'm not sure how hard it is to actually compile though.
It can be hard if you don't have a compatible setup to how the devs built their applications (ie, operating system, library version, devkitpro version). New and old updates can break stuff, and source codes not provide the entirety of the make-build. People aren't typically going to bother setting up devkitPro for changing out one little thing.

This should be easy enough request to do. Currently setting up libnds to see if his source code gives no problem.

Edit - Arlight, back. Sorry, I'm having compiling issues. Getting errors when building. Thinks it's due to abad devkitpro environment setup on my computer. Someone else here or at the ROM Hacking, Translations and Utilities section who is better equipped at this should help you.
 
Last edited by TurdPooCharger,
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
Okay, im back. After some headbanging trying to figure how why NTR Launcher was so different than a typical .cia, I found out it is a DSiWare based.

I couldn't use the typical arsenal of DSBuff, DSLazy, DotNet 3DS Toolkit, and HackingToolkit9DS to modify the banner.bin for icon and name editing.

The only way this is going to work is to extract the files within the game's .app file using GodMode9, open the banner.bin file under MessAnimDSIco, change the title and icon there, and then hex edit inject back this banner.bin into NTR Launcher's .app file.

I'll have to check if the CIA installs correctly with FBI, but feel more or less confident this request is possibl.e

@wormdood, do you have a particular picture and title for how you want the icon to look like and game name?

ie, simply "NTR Launcher"

and whatever the 32 x 32 px icon will be.
 

wormdood

pirate booty inspector
OP
Member
Joined
Jan 3, 2014
Messages
5,256
Trophies
2
Age
38
Location
behind a parental advisory sticker
XP
4,191
Country
United States
Are you referring to NTR Launcher?

icon.png


NTR Launcher
NitroHax provided by chishm
Modified by Apache Thunder

Is so, what do you prefer this icon to be and those lines written as?
the app in question is this one R4 Stage2 TWL Flashcart Launcher(and perhaps other cards soon™).... (the first link) it shows as "a.k. rpg" i was hoping to change it to say games . . . and as for the icon possibly have a pic of a folder or something generic like say games in rainbow colored letters on a flat background
 
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
yes and it is also dsiware based

Can you link to me or point exactly which archive containing the cia i'm looking for? There's a lot. Don't want to get the wrong one lol.

Edit - oh you mentioned first link. For icon, you said rainbow based. You have particular rainbow or a pic from google image search?
 
Last edited by TurdPooCharger,

Dracari

Well-Known Member
Member
Joined
Apr 5, 2009
Messages
1,985
Trophies
1
XP
2,465
Country
United States
Actually dont those launchers Rely on using a patched sysmodule? TwlBg.cxi i think, does Luma still Support loading a Patched TWL(DSI)Module at all anymore O-o?
 

Apache Thunder

I have cameras in your head!
Member
Joined
Oct 7, 2007
Messages
4,433
Trophies
3
Age
36
Location
Levelland, Texas
Website
www.mariopc.co.nr
XP
6,805
Country
United States
There is no "source code" to the R4 launcher you were using. Well there's source to WoodRPG I guess, but I did not use any source code to make the stage2 launchers. They are manually rebuilt SRLs with the needed changes to operate on a 3DS with TWL_FIRM (also none of my launchers require a patched/modified TWL_FIRM. There was a short time when NTR Launcher first came out that it was needed but we later figured out how to switch into NTR mode from TWL mode so we no longer use a modified NTR mode with hacked in unlocked SCFG support.

There is however source code to NTR Launcher and perhaps you should use that instead. It should boot your R4 just as well and would even give you extra options like the ability to run DS games with TWL clock speeds enabled. This can help with a few DS games known to have frame rate issues. Though it may not fix them all. :P
 
  • Like
Reactions: wormdood
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
thats fine
After more head bashing due to the pickiness of DSBuff nagging about 16-bit colors for 32x32 pixel icon in which that duck folder picture only contained 8-bits of colors (did some PhotoShop trickery to get the other 8 colors), injecting that icon into a different DSiWare cia title (Zelda - Four Swords), hex edit splicing that icon over into the banner.bin of Wood R4 because manually recreating that icon on MessAnimDSIco required clicking 1024 pixels is NOT smart, then injecting that banner.bin file into Wood R4 Launcher's "F5A5C974.app" by more hex editing, copy+paste by GodMode9 that modified .app into SysNAND location of "2:/title/00030004/41464645/content", search TMD tickets, and finally recreate / build that launcher into a new CIA format.

I've uninstalled the original Wood R4 Launcher and reinstalled this new one. It launches when I tried it. Let me know if it works for you.

There is no "source code" to the R4 launcher you were using...

... Though it may not fix them all. :P

Hey, man. It's cool I tinkered your Wood R4 Launcher like that, so long if this makes OP and his kid happy? I don't like messing with stuff if not need be.

Edit - modified R4 Launcher .cia has been pulled as request was fulfilled, and to prevent circulation and contamination of unofficial build.
 
Last edited by TurdPooCharger,
Joined
Jan 1, 2018
Messages
7,292
Trophies
2
XP
5,947
Country
United States
ok so i got around to attempting to install the file and fbi gives me an error

failed to install cia file
result code 0xdd8e0806c
level permanent (27)
summery invalid argument (7)
module am (32)
desc error type -8 (108)

Which exact 3DS or 2DS are you trying to install this on? What version of FBI, Luma, and B9S? Is the R4 Wood already preinstalled from the original one? Do you have another system to test installing the cia on?

* If it matters, I installed this FBI v.2.5.0 3dsx version.

R4_Wood_Games.png


Edit - I'll be away for the time being due to family airport pickup.
I'll re-upload this CIA in question for others to try installing. This way, they can chime in if the problem occurs on their end, too, and then we'll know whether it bad cia hack or something else.

Edit #2 - Pulled .cia as it is believed the build works only on one system due to differences in:
- cert.bin
- tmd.bin
- tmdchunks.bin
 
Last edited by TurdPooCharger,

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• BakerMan @ BakerMan:
    an elder scrolls movie or show would be cool, but which elder scrolls game would it be based on?
  • BakerMan @ BakerMan:
    oh who am i kidding it'd be skyrim
    +1
  • BakerMan @ BakerMan:
    but,since they're only a few years apart, a morrowind + oblivion series would also be cool
  • K3Nv2 @ K3Nv2:
    Taco Saturday
  • AncientBoi @ AncientBoi:
    Uhh, It's 🌯 Saturday dude. :) js
  • BigOnYa @ BigOnYa:
    Nope that for tomorrow, cinco de mayo, today is bbq chicken on the grill.
  • K3Nv2 @ K3Nv2:
    Juan's new years I forgot
    +2
  • AncientBoi @ AncientBoi:
    :hrth::toot::grog::grog::grog::bow: HAPPY BIRTHDAY to me :bow::grog::grog::toot::hrth:
  • K3Nv2 @ K3Nv2:
    One day away from Juan's birthday
  • K3Nv2 @ K3Nv2:
    Only if you send him feet
    +1
  • BigOnYa @ BigOnYa:
    Happy birthday!
    +1
  • AncientBoi @ AncientBoi:
    Thank You :D
  • realtimesave @ realtimesave:
    heh I got a guy who created an account just yesterday asking me where to find mig switch roms
  • realtimesave @ realtimesave:
    too much FBI watching this website to answer that kind of question lol
  • K3Nv2 @ K3Nv2:
    Has the mig switch found loopholes without requiring game keys?
  • Xdqwerty @ Xdqwerty:
    @AncientBoi, happy birthday
  • Xdqwerty @ Xdqwerty:
    Yawn
  • Xdqwerty @ Xdqwerty:
    Lonely here
  • Xdqwerty @ Xdqwerty:
    Anybody?
  • Psionic Roshambo @ Psionic Roshambo:
    I want my money back... Drug test? No drugs to test but they want me to pee in a cup! Lol
  • K3Nv2 @ K3Nv2:
    Better call Pedro you're up in smoke
    K3Nv2 @ K3Nv2: Better call Pedro you're up in smoke